binary tree python geeksforgeeks

Given a Linked List Representation of Complete Binary Tree. Tree represents the nodes connected by edges.


Pin On Bca

Every node other than the root is associated with one parent node.

. The complete binary tree is represented as a linked list in a way where if root node is stored at position i its left and right children are stored at. If there are multiple bottom-most nodes for a horizontal distance from root then print the later one in level traversal. What is an ADT Write an algorithm to insert an element into BST.

Tutorial on Binary Tree. Given a binary tree find if it is height balanced or not. All the leaf nodes except for the ones that are.

Here is the simple Python program to create a binary tree add nodes and read the value of a particular node in the binary tree. Each node in a binary tree contains data and references to its children. 1 2 3 Output.

Also the smaller tree or the subtree in the left of the root node is called the. The tree will be created based on the height of each. Inorder Successor of a node in Binary Tree.

Name age NID and height. Create a binary search tree in which each node stores the following information of a person. Populate Inorder Successor for all nodes.

The tree is a hierarchical Data Structure. The task is to construct the Binary tree. Bst generates a random binary search tree and return its root node.

How the search for an element in a binary search tree. Binary Search Tree is a node-based binary tree data structure which has the following properties. Given a Binary Tree find its Boundary Traversal.

Defined as the path from the root to the left-most node ie- the leaf node you could reach when you always travel preferring the left subtree over the right subtree. Binary tree python geeksforgeeks. Since each element in a binary tree can have only 2 children we typically name them the left and right child.

It has the following properties. A tree is height balanced if difference between heights of left and right subtrees is not more than one for all nodes of tree. The binary search tree is a special type of tree data structure whose inorder gives a sorted list of nodes or vertices.

Binary search tree in python geeksforgeeks. The traversal should be in the following order. In Python we can directly create a BST object using binarytree module.

Your task is to complete the function Ancestors that finds all the ancestors of the key in the given binary tree. It has the following properties. 2 1 3 Output.

The tree will be created based on the height of each. Given a level K you have to find out the sum of data of all the nodes at level K in a binary tree. Tree S is a subtree of T if both inorder and preorder traversals of S arew substrings of inorder and preorder traversals of T respectively.

Your task is to complete the function Ancestors that finds all the ancestors of the key in the given binary tree. Both the children are named as left child and the right child according to their position. Cremation society of sc greenville sc.

A binary tree is a tree that has at most two children. Your task is to complete the function height which takes root node of the tree as input parameter and returns an integer denoting the height of the tree. You dont need to read input or print anything.

Binarytreebst height3 is_perfectFalse Parameters. Print Postorder traversal from given Inorder and Preorder traversals. 1 2 3 Output.

A tree is represented by a. Def __init__ self val leftNone rightNone. It means that each node in a binary tree can have either one or two or no children.

Binary tree python geeksforgeeks. A tree whose elements have at most 2 children is called a binary tree. The return type is cpp.

The max difference in height of left subtree and right subtree is 2 which is greater than 1. For example in the below diagram 3 and 4 are both the bottommost nodes at horizontal distance 0 we need to print 4. For the above tree the output should be 5 10 4 14 25.

One node is marked as Root node. Given a binary tree find its height. A binary tree is a tree data structure in which each node can have a maximum of 2 children.

Check for Balanced Tree. Name age NID and height. Since each element in a binary tree can have only 2 children we typically name them the left and right child.

Create a binary search tree in which each node stores the following information of a person. For the above tree the bottom view is 5 10 3 14 25. Find n-th node of inorder traversal.

H is the height of the tree and this space is used implicitly for the recursion stack. How the search for an element in a binary search tree. Given a binary tree find if it is height balanced or not.

Python - Binary Tree. What is an ADT Write an algorithm to insert an element into BST. It is a non-linear data structure.

The node which is on the left of the Binary Tree is called Left-Child and the node which is the right is called Right-Child. Selfleftleft selfvalval selfrightright adding element in the binary tree. Replace each node in binary tree with the sum of its inorder predecessor and successor.

Tree generates a random binary tree and returns its root node. Structureclass for a node by defult left and right pointers are None class node. Find all possible binary trees with given Inorder Traversal.

Binary tree python geeksforgeeks.


Flood Fill Algorithm How To Implement Fill In Paint Geeksforgeeks Flood Fill Logical Thinking Algorithm


Pin On Technology


Pin On Algorithms


Pin On Mathematics Algorithms


Faster Lists In Python Level Up Coding Python Time Complexity Binary Tree


How To Become Data Scientist A Complete Roadmap Geeksforgeeks Data Scientist Data Science Learning Data Science


Tree Question Solution From Geeksforgeeks Problem Solving Solving Data Visualization


Pin On Tab Keeper Placeholder


3 Best Practices Java Programmers Can Learn From Spring Framework Business Logic Spring Framework Java Programming Tutorials


Sigma S Is The Standard Notation For Writing Long Sums Learn How It Is Used In This Video Notations Ap Calculus Ab Ap Calculus


Write A Program To Calculate Pow X N Geeksforgeeks Writing Calculator Algorithm


Finding The Shortest Path In Javascript Dijkstras Algorithm Dijkstra S Algorithm Algorithm Binary Tree


Tree Data Structure Is A Collection Of Nodes Data Which Are Organized In Hierarchical Structure There Are Binary Tree Hierarchical Structure Data Structures


Double Pointer Pointer To Pointer In C Geeksforgeeks Pointers Interview Questions Helping Others


Infix To Postfix Conversion Algorithm Data Structures Data Visualization


How To Become Data Scientist A Complete Roadmap Geeksforgeeks Data Scientist Data Science Learning Data Science


Python Document Field Detection Using Template Matching Geeksforgeeks Algorithm Interview Questions Computer Science


Algorithm Complexity Algorithm Math Questions Distributed Computing


How To Automate An Excel Sheet In Python Geeksforgeeks Data Science Learning Learn Computer Science Python

Iklan Atas Artikel

Iklan Tengah Artikel 1

Iklan Tengah Artikel 2

Iklan Bawah Artikel